We are seeking individuals at the Consultant to Director level to join our Data & Analytic and Data Governance divisions, with the below skillsets.

Strategy, Growth & Digital

  • Data Scientist: Using Data Science techniques and Machine Learning skills over Big Data
  • Data Engineer: Engineering modern data solutions or pipelines to facilitate advanced analytics, visualisation & interactive data applications
  • Data Analyst: Analysing and business consulting with data – using relational databases (SQL), data workbench & visualisation tools for project delivery, applying business logic and interpreting results
  • Data Management Specialist: strong understanding of data management principles and how to apply them including knowledge of models such as DCAM, DMBOK, regulatory frameworks such as BCBS 239, CPG 235 and principles and practices of data quality, lineage, master / reference data management
